What is a 6-Foot Shipping Container?

A 6-foot shipping container is a compact, durable structure created mainly for storage and transport. It is much shorter than the standard shipping containers, generally closer to the 20-foot and 40-foot versions. Its measurements make it a perfect option for services or people requiring portable storage options without needing comprehensive space.

Six-foot shipping containers use innovative solutions across different sectors. Here are some typical applications:

  1. Storage Solutions: Ideal for property areas or services needing area for seasonal items, tools, or inventory.
  2. Mobile Retail Stores: Retailers can convert these containers into pop-up buy festivals or seasonal events.
  3. Workshops: Craftsmen and craftsmens can utilize them for on-site offices, geared up with their tools and products.
  4. Catastrophe Relief: Organizations can utilize them for short-lived shelters or storage of necessary products during emergency situations.
  5. Events and Exhibitions: Containers can be transformed into unique exhibit areas or food stalls.

Benefits of 6-Foot Shipping Containers

While standard storage options exist, 6-foot shipping containers boast various advantages, such as:

  • Portability: Easy to transport and relocate, making them perfect for dynamic activities or changing requirements.
  • Resilience: Made from robust materials that endure extreme climate condition and use tensions.
  • Cost-Effectiveness: Generally more cost effective than bigger containers or conventional storage systems, offering an effective option for budget-conscious users.
  • Customizability: They can be tailored for particular requirements, consisting of windows, doors, insulation, and power supply alternatives.
  • Eco-Friendly: Recycling shipping containers lowers waste, and their reusability adds to sustainable practices.
Choosing the Right Container for Your Needs

When thinking about a 6-foot shipping container, there are several factors to remember:

  1. Purpose: Determine how you mean to use the container, whether for storage, retail, or a workshop.
  2. Location: Ensure that the area you have can accommodate the container, considering local guidelines and access points.
  3. Condition: Inspect for structural stability, rust, or damage, especially if purchasing utilized containers.
  4. Modification: Understand your requirements for adjustments and whether the seller offers additional services in this regard.

Regularly Asked Questions

1. Just how much does a 6-foot shipping container typically cost?

The price can vary based on condition (new or used), adjustments, and delivery expenses. On average, they can vary from ₤ 1,500 to ₤ 5,000.

2. Can I utilize a 6-foot shipping container for long-lasting storage?

Yes, 6-foot containers appropriate for long-term storage, given their sturdiness and secure locks. They keep products safe from weather and theft.

3. Do I need an authorization to position a shipping container on my residential or commercial property?

Authorization requirements differ by area. It is recommended to check local zoning laws and policies to make sure compliance before putting a container on your residential or commercial property.

4. Are shipping containers suitable for climate-sensitive goods?

While shipping containers are weather-resistant, they are not insulated. If you prepare to save temperature-sensitive products, extra insulation or climate control functions may be required.

5. Can I customize a 6-foot shipping container?

Yes, many companies offer customization services allowing adjustments such as windows, doors, shelving, and insulation to suit numerous requirements.

6. What is the life-span of a shipping container?

With proper upkeep, shipping containers can last 25 years or more. Regular inspections and rust avoidance treatments can significantly extend their lifespan.
